> Has anyone seen problems like this before? Is the Mega128 internal > BOD not capable of handling slow voltage rises? I've seen it on other processors. About nothing built can handle reaaaaaally slow rise times. Some manufacturers give a rise time spec (eg Philips), some don't (eg Zilog (in cases I am aware of). In the latter type of cases you can claim failure to meet published specs, but don't expect that to help. If you have really slow rise times the only guaranteed way to fix things is to control the power supply turn on. Effectively provide a brown out detector on the power supply and never apply power to the IC until you can turn it up at a guaranteed OK rate. Sounds drastic but anything less can cause problems. Ask me how I know ;-) . RM -- http://www.piclist.com PIC/SX FAQ & list archive View/change your membership options at http://mailman.mit.edu/mailman/listinfo/piclist